Article: Intracellular and Extracellular Concentrations of Na^sup +^ Modulate Mg^sup 2+^ Transport in Rat Ventricular Myocytes

ABSTRACT

Apparent free cytoplasmic concentrations of Mg^sup 2+^ ([Mg^sup 2+^]^sub i^) and Na+ ([Na+]^sub i^) were estimated in rat ventricular myocytes using fluorescent indicators, furaptra (mag-fura-2) for Mg^sup 2+^ and sodium-binding benzofuran isophthalate for Na+, at 25°C in Ca^sup 2+^-free conditions. Analysis included corrections for the influence of Na+ on furaptra fluorescence found in vitro and in vivo. The myocytes were loaded with Mg^sup 2+^ in a solution containing 24 mM Mg^sup 2+^ either in the presence of 106 mM Na+ plus 1 mM ouabain (Na+ loading) or in the presence of only 1.6 mM Na+ to deplete the cells of Na+ (Na+ depletion).
